Fine-Tuning Product Regimens for Warmer Days


Among one of the most effective ways to revitalize a skincare procedure is by reconsidering the items your customers make use of daily. As temperature levels climb, hefty occlusive items might no more offer them well. Think about advising lighter hydration and changing from abundant moisturizers to gel-based or water-based options.


Cleansing is one more essential area where subtle changes can make a significant difference. In the springtime, the skin might create more oil and sweat, especially with boosted activity and time outdoors. Suggest stabilizing cleansers that sustain the skin barrier while thoroughly removing contaminations. Urge customers to prevent harsh removing items, which can set off more oil manufacturing and sensitivity.


Obviously, SPF is non-negotiable year-round, but springtime is a suitable time to double down on sunlight security. With longer daylight hours and even more time spent outside, a broad-spectrum SPF needs to belong to every morning regimen. Offer customers choices that feel light-weight and breathable to support everyday wear.

Resolving Seasonal Skin Stressors Head-On


Springtime isn't simply sunlight and roses. It also brings seasonal allergies, increased plant pollen, and a greater chance of irritability or flare-ups. As an aggressive skincare professional, prepare for these problems and develop preventative steps into your customer procedures.


Search for signs of animated skin, such as inflammation, dryness, or itching, especially in customers susceptible to seasonal allergies. Concentrate on calming ingredients and obstacle support. Advise way of life changes, such as cleaning the face after being outdoors, to lower allergen direct exposure.


Hydration stays essential, also as humidity surges. However hydration does not have to suggest heavy. Urge the use of hydrating hazes, serums with hyaluronic acid, and light-weight creams that take in promptly while keeping the skin plump.

Making Protocol Adjustments Personal


No 2 skins are alike, which means no 2 springtime procedures must be identical. Use this seasonal shift as a possibility to reconnect with customers on an individual level. Offer springtime skin check-ins or mini-consultations to analyze progression and make thoughtful modifications.


Listen to their concerns. Are they really feeling oily? Bursting out much more? Discovering pigmentation or soreness? Utilize their feedback to guide your changes. You could suggest incorporating active ingredients like niacinamide for soothing, vitamin C for brightening, or light-weight antioxidants to sustain skin throughout increased sunlight exposure.
